When you want to read or modify software version-specific data, use logical
addressing. The following table contains a memory map for the 16-bit logical address
space.

If you give the ADDR command with no parameter, it displays the current
addressing mode. All parameters must be entered in lower case.
EXAMPLE
dbg>addr a
sm and rm commands apply absolute addressing.
dbg>addr l
sm and rm commands apply logical addressing.
dbg>addr
sm and rm commands apply logical addressing.
